About the Item

Antique print titled 'Views of the Coast of Kamtschatka (..)'. Print with coastal views of Kamchatka including volcanoes. Originates from 'A Voyage to the Pacific Ocean: Undertaken, by the Command of His Majesty, for Making Discoveries in the Northern Hemisphere (..)' published in Dublin. Artists and Engravers: James Cook (Author, 1728-1779) was a British captain, explorer and cartographer. Condition: Good, some wear and age-related toning. Defect lower left corner. Please study image carefully. Date: 1784 Overall size: 45 x 29 cm. Image size: 39 x 23 cm.
